Viewpoints is a movement philosophy that explores the issues of time and space. In theater, it allows a group of actors to function spontaneously and intuitively; to generate bold new work quickly by developing flexibility, articulation, and strength in movement; and to use writing and other resources as steps to creativity. Students will learn the vocabulary and basic theory by applying viewpoints to creating new compositions as well as using them with existing theatrical texts. 1 CREDIT PREREQUISITES: 31-2200 ACTING II: ADVANCED SCENE STUDY OR 31-2700 DIRECTING I
